Benefits of Booking Wedding Hair and Makeup Artists in Sicily
Booking wedding hair and makeup artists in Sicily, Italy gives you professional support for both the creative and practical sides of bridal beauty. The goal is not simply to “look made up”, but to create a complete bridal look that suits your features, your outfit, the venue, the season, and the rhythm of the day.
Before the wedding, a bridal hair and makeup artist can discuss inspiration, skin preparation, hairstyle options, accessories, veil placement, and the best timing for a trial. This helps you understand what is realistic and what will photograph well.
On the wedding day, the artist manages the beauty schedule, prepares the bride and any agreed bridal party members, and makes adjustments based on light, temperature, and the final styling details. This kind of structure is particularly valuable when the ceremony begins early or when several people need services.
After the ceremony, some artists can provide touch-ups, a hairstyle change, or makeup refreshes for portraits and the evening reception. This is useful for long celebrations, outdoor events, warm weather, or weddings with multiple locations.
For a destination wedding in Sicily, working with an experienced wedding makeup artist or bridal hairstylist also means having someone who understands local timing, travel logistics, venue preparation spaces, and the standards expected by international couples planning a wedding in Italy.
Bridal Hair and Makeup Prices in Sicily: What to Expect
Prices for bridal hair and makeup in Sicily can vary widely, so it is useful to think in service levels rather than one fixed number. A local makeup artist or hairstylist may offer a bridal service from around €300–€500, while a more experienced wedding hair and makeup artist working with destination couples may charge approximately €500–€900.
Luxury bridal beauty services can be significantly higher. Quotes above €1,000 are not unusual when the artist includes on-site preparation, travel, a more detailed consultation, assistant support, or availability for touch-ups after the ceremony. This is especially relevant for weddings with several people needing beauty services or a tight morning schedule.
Typical cost factors include:
- The bride’s hair and makeup package.
- The cost of a bridal trial before the wedding.
- Makeup or hairstyling for bridesmaids, mothers, and guests.
- Travel to the venue in Sicily.
- Early morning starts, extra assistants, lashes, extensions, or touch-ups.
Guest services are often priced separately, commonly from about €50–€170 per person per service. Trials may start around €100, but premium trials can cost several hundred euros. Before booking wedding hair and makeup artists in Sicily, Italy, ask for a detailed quote that separates bride, trial, guests, travel, and extras, so you can compare offers clearly.
Finding the Right Wedding Hairstylist and Makeup Artist in Sicily
The best wedding hair and makeup artists in Sicily, Italy are usually those who combine a refined aesthetic with a clear, reliable process. Beauty is personal, but wedding-day beauty also has to last, photograph well, and fit into a precise schedule.
Start with compatibility. Look for an artist whose portfolio already includes bridal looks close to your taste. This may mean soft romantic hair, elegant updos, glowing skin, natural makeup, defined eyes, or a more editorial finish.
Then check experience. A professional used to weddings will know how to work with photographers, planners, venue timelines, and possible delays. This is important in Sicily, where couples may be planning remotely and relying on local expertise.
Finally, confirm the details. Ask about travel fees, trial availability, assistant support, start times, touch-up options, false lashes, hair padding, extensions, product hygiene, and how many people can be prepared before the ceremony.
Do not choose only by price. A lower quote may not include a trial, travel, bridal party services, or enough preparation time. A higher quote may reflect experience, better products, extra support, or a more complete service. The right bridal hair and makeup artist should give you confidence in both the look and the logistics.
Bridal Hair and Makeup Services for Destination Weddings in Sicily
Destination weddings require beauty services that are flexible, organized, and easy to coordinate from abroad. Wedding hair and makeup artists in Sicily often work with couples who are planning remotely, so clear communication before the event is an important part of the service.
A complete bridal beauty service may include consultation, trial, wedding-day makeup, hairstyling, lashes, accessory placement, bridal party services, touch-ups, and travel to the venue. Not every artist offers the same package, so it is important to confirm exactly what is available before booking.
Communication: share your date, venue, preparation address, ceremony time, number of people, and preferred style as early as possible.
Practical planning: ask about travel fees, early starts, assistant availability, payment terms, and how long the artist stays on site.
Beauty details: discuss skin type, hair texture, allergies, extensions, veil, accessories, desired makeup intensity, and any concerns about heat or humidity.
For a wedding in Sicily, the right bridal hair and makeup artist should make the process feel clear from the first message. Their role is to create a polished look, but also to help the morning run smoothly, keep timing under control, and give the bride confidence before the ceremony begins.

Practical FAQ for Booking Wedding Beauty Artists in Sicily
What information should I send when requesting a quote?
Send your wedding date, venue or preparation address in Sicily, ceremony time, number of people needing hair and makeup, preferred style, trial needs, and any touch-up requests. This helps wedding hair and makeup artists provide a more accurate quote.
Is bridal hair and makeup priced separately?
Some artists price hair and makeup separately, while others offer a combined bridal package. Bridesmaids, mothers, and guests are usually priced per person and per service. Always ask for a written breakdown to understand what is included.
Can the artist work with different skin tones and hair textures?
A professional bridal makeup artist or wedding hairstylist should be able to discuss experience with different skin tones, skin types, hair textures, and beauty needs. Check the portfolio and ask direct questions if you have specific requirements.
What if I have sensitive skin or allergies?
Mention allergies, sensitivities, acne-prone skin, rosacea, dry skin, oily skin, or product preferences before the trial or wedding day. The artist may adapt products and techniques, but they need this information early to prepare properly.
Should I wash my hair before the appointment?
Follow the artist’s instructions, because the best preparation depends on your hair type and chosen hairstyle. Some styles work better with freshly washed hair, while others need more texture. Ask before the wedding day to avoid uncertainty.
Can the artist help with veil and accessory placement?
Many wedding hairstylists can place veils, pins, tiaras, combs, flowers, or other hair accessories. Bring all accessories to the trial if possible, and have them ready during preparation so the final hairstyle can be completed correctly.
What is the difference between bridal makeup and guest makeup?
Bridal makeup usually involves more consultation, detailed preparation, longer timing, stronger durability, and careful coordination with the overall wedding look. Guest makeup is generally shorter and simpler, though it should still be polished and suitable for photos.
How can I compare artists fairly?
Compare portfolio style, experience, communication, service details, travel policy, timing, reviews, trial options, and total price. For wedding hair and makeup artists in Sicily, Italy, the best choice is the one that fits both your aesthetic and your planning needs.
